As adjectives, eccentric and freaky are synonyms defined as:
  • eccentric and freaky: conspicuously or grossly unconventional or unusual
Other synonyms of eccentric include bizarre, flakey, flaky, freakish, gonzo, off-the-wall, outlandish, outre.
